Consumer Review Video - 2016 Toyota RAV4 Limited 2.5L 4 Cyl.

Car Displayed: 2016 Toyota RAV4 Limited 2.5L 4 Cyl.

The 2016 Toyota RAV4 Limited is a relatively easy vehicle to maintain. The battery has unobstructed access to the terminals and the bracket, so jumpstarting or replacing it shouldn’t be a problem. Some of the headlights are accessible by simply reaching behind the bulb housing, which will allow for reliable bulb changes. The engine air filter is also easy to change as the filter housing disengages without the use of tools.

However, the 2016 Toyota RAV4 Limited does have its share of difficulties. You’ll need to remove a large panel from underneath the vehicle for access to the petcock, which will put you in an awkward working position. The wheel well lining will need to be pried back for access to the fog lights, which won’t allow for reliable bulb changes. Reaching the tail lights may also be a problem as you’ll have to take out the entire bulb housing first.
